5

Ứng dụng của tôi mất rất nhiều thời gian để khởi chạy màn hình Hoạt động đầu tiên. Nó sẽ hiển thị màn hình trắng trong thời gian dài. Ngay cả sau khi giết ứng dụng của tôi và truy cập.Ứng dụng của tôi dành rất nhiều thời gian để khởi chạy màn hình Hoạt động đầu tiên

Tôi đang sử dụng Java 8 và Android Studio 2.1.1, Gradle phiên bản như com.android.tools.build:gradle:2.1.0

+0

Hãy thử định hình mất bao lâu và không có các SDK đó khi khởi động? – fractalwrench

Trả lời

4

nếu bạn đang tung ra ứng dụng lần đầu tiên nó mất thời gian để tải , sau đó khi bạn mở nó lần thứ hai nó không mất thời gian để mở.

Bạn đang sử dụng debug_apk. thử tạo apk đăng ký phát hành một lần và kiểm tra xem có cần thời gian hay không.

+0

Cảm ơn, đã làm việc cho tôi –

2

Theo kinh nghiệm của tôi, Fabric tiêu tốn một chút thời gian để thiết lập kết nối và liên lạc.

Tôi khuyên bạn nên nhận xét phần Vải trên mã và chạy lại để xem liệu có bất kỳ thay đổi nào trong thời gian tải ứng dụng hay không.

Ngoài ra, bạn có thể di chuyển mã vào tác vụ không đồng bộ thay vì thực hiện các tác vụ này trên chuỗi chính. Nó sẽ ít nhất là không làm chậm thời gian khởi động ứng dụng ban đầu ur.

3

séc này trong Android studio -> File -> Setting -> Build -> Xóa đánh dấu sau đây tùy chọn của enter image description here

2

Nếu bạn có một hình ảnh trong đó cho thấy trong màn hình splash và nếu chỉ có hình ảnh mật độ đơn, hãy đặt nó trong thư mục draw-xxxhdpi.

+0

đây không phải là vấn đề của tôi, tôi kích hoạt insta chạy sau khi vô hiệu hóa tiền phạt của nó. –

+0

Có Chạy tức thì cũng gây ra sự cố. –

+0

điều này đã giúp tôi +1 – Bawa

Các vấn đề liên quan